云服务器应用镜像和系统镜像,云服务器购买选择哪个镜像
- 综合资讯
- 2024-09-30 01:54:59
- 3
***:在云服务器购买时,面临应用镜像和系统镜像的选择。系统镜像提供基础的操作系统环境,如Windows或Linux系统,适合有自定义安装软件和配置需求的用户。应用镜像...
***:探讨云服务器购买时应用镜像和系统镜像的选择问题。云服务器镜像分为应用镜像和系统镜像,两者各具特点。系统镜像提供基础的操作系统环境,适合有特定系统需求及自行配置软件的用户;应用镜像则集成了特定应用,能让用户快速部署包含特定应用的环境。在购买云服务器时,需根据自身业务需求、技术能力、是否追求快速部署等因素来决定选择哪种镜像。
《云服务器镜像选择全解析:应用镜像与系统镜像的考量》
在购买云服务器时,镜像的选择是一个至关重要的决策,它直接影响着云服务器的功能、性能以及后续的使用体验,云服务器主要提供应用镜像和系统镜像两种类型,下面我们将详细探讨如何根据自身需求进行选择。
一、系统镜像
1、Linux系统镜像
CentOS
- CentOS是企业级应用中非常受欢迎的Linux发行版,它以稳定性著称,具有强大的社区支持,对于搭建Web服务器(如Apache或Nginx)、数据库服务器(如MySQL或PostgreSQL)等来说是一个很好的选择,CentOS的软件包管理系统(yum)方便用户安装和更新各种软件包,如果要搭建一个企业级的内部网站,CentOS可以提供稳定的运行环境,能够轻松应对高并发的用户访问请求,CentOS在安全更新方面也比较及时,可以有效保护服务器免受安全威胁。
Ubuntu
- Ubuntu以其易用性和丰富的软件库而闻名,对于新手来说,Ubuntu的图形化安装界面和相对简单的命令行操作使得服务器的初始配置更加容易,它在云计算和容器化(如Docker)领域应用广泛,当开发人员想要快速部署一个测试环境来运行基于容器的应用程序时,Ubuntu可以提供便捷的基础环境,Ubuntu还有定期的版本更新,能够及时引入新的功能和安全补丁。
Debian
- Debian以其高度的稳定性和安全性而受到青睐,它遵循严格的软件包管理原则,软件包之间的兼容性较好,对于一些对安全性要求极高的应用场景,如金融机构的内部服务器或者加密数据存储服务器,Debian可以提供可靠的保障,Debian的更新策略相对保守,这有助于避免因更新带来的潜在兼容性问题。
2、Windows系统镜像
Windows Server
- 如果企业的应用程序是基于Windows技术栈构建的,如.NET应用程序或者依赖于Windows特定的服务(如Active Directory),那么选择Windows Server镜像就非常必要,Windows Server提供了图形化的管理界面,方便管理员进行各种设置,如用户管理、文件共享等,它也支持多种企业级应用,如SQL Server数据库,Windows Server需要购买相应的许可证,并且在资源占用方面相对Linux系统可能会更多一些。
二、应用镜像
1、Web应用镜像
- 许多云服务提供商提供了预配置的Web应用镜像,如WordPress镜像,对于想要快速搭建博客、企业宣传网站等的用户来说,选择WordPress镜像可以节省大量的时间和精力,这些应用镜像通常已经安装好了Web服务器(如Apache或Nginx)、数据库(如MySQL)以及WordPress本身,并进行了基本的配置,用户只需要进行一些简单的定制,如选择主题、添加插件等就可以使网站上线,同样,还有其他的Web应用镜像,如Joomla、Drupal等,适用于不同类型的Web项目。
2、数据库应用镜像
- 云服务提供商也提供了数据库应用镜像,例如MySQL镜像,对于需要快速部署数据库服务器的开发团队或者小型企业来说,选择MySQL镜像可以避免繁琐的安装和配置过程,这些镜像通常已经进行了优化,并且可以根据需求方便地调整数据库的参数,如内存分配、存储引擎选择等,还有PostgreSQL、MongoDB等数据库的应用镜像可供选择,以满足不同的数据存储和管理需求。
3、开发环境镜像
- 针对开发人员,云服务提供商提供了各种开发环境镜像,包含Python开发环境的镜像,已经安装好了Python解释器、常用的开发库(如NumPy、Pandas等)以及开发工具(如IDE集成开发环境),这对于开发人员来说,可以快速开始项目的开发工作,无需在服务器上花费大量时间安装和配置开发环境,同样,还有Java、Node.js等开发环境的镜像,方便不同技术栈的开发人员使用。
在选择云服务器镜像时,首先要明确自己的业务需求,如果是进行一般性的Web开发或者测试,应用镜像可能会更适合,可以快速上手,如果是构建企业级的基础架构,如邮件服务器、文件服务器等,系统镜像则是更好的选择,以便根据企业的具体需求进行定制化的配置,还要考虑成本、技术支持以及未来的可扩展性等因素,合适的镜像选择是云服务器成功部署和高效运行的关键。
本文链接:https://www.zhitaoyun.cn/61772.html
发表评论